Josh.ai
Best for: Home automation installers who want to deliver a premium, AI-enhanced smart home experience with seamless device integration and a focus on user experience.
Josh.ai is an AI-powered smart home platform designed to provide a seamless, intelligent experience for homeowners and professionals alike. According to their website, Josh.ai uses advanced AI to orchestrate connected devices across the home through a single, intuitive interface. The platform supports a wide range of devices, including lights, thermostats, security cameras, garage doors, and entertainment systems, and integrates with major ecosystems like Alexa, Google Assistant, and Apple HomeKit. The Josh App, available on iOS and Android, provides elegant control with customizable settings and a beautiful interface. Key features include voice and touch control, proactive alerts for security vulnerabilities, and over-the-air updates to continuously improve functionality. The platform emphasizes privacy, with data protection built into its design. For home automation installers, Josh.ai offers a powerful solution to create intelligent, personalized home environments. The system is designed to be future-proof, with regular updates that expand capabilities without requiring hardware changes. According to research, Josh.ai is particularly strong in delivering a 'magical' user experience, with contextual awareness that simplifies complex actions. However, it’s important to note that Josh.ai is primarily a device control platform, not a business website or lead generation tool. Installers can use it to demonstrate advanced automation during installations, but it doesn’t include features like automated content creation, AI-driven lead capture, or business intelligence reporting. The platform is ideal for integrators who want to deliver a premium, AI-enhanced experience but requires a separate website and marketing strategy to attract and convert customers.

Crestron
Best for: Home automation installers specializing in high-end, custom luxury homes who need a powerful, scalable system for in-home device control and integration.
Crestron is a leading provider of luxury home automation systems, offering comprehensive, custom-built solutions for high-end residential projects. According to their website, Crestron Home delivers a 'simply smart' sanctuary with centralized control over lighting, security, climate, audio, and video. The system is tailored to each home, with a scalable network that can support over 250 devices. Crestron’s platform includes a sleek interface, a budgeting tool for initial cost estimation, and options for wellness integrations. The system is designed for the luxury market and requires professional installation. For home automation installers, Crestron represents a premium solution for large-scale, complex projects. It excels in delivering seamless, whole-home control with a focus on design and integration. The system is highly expandable, allowing for future upgrades and additions without major overhauls. However, Crestron is not a website or marketing tool. It’s a hardware and software platform for managing in-home devices, not for attracting new customers or generating leads. Installers can use Crestron to showcase their technical expertise and deliver a high-end experience, but they must rely on separate websites and marketing strategies to drive business. The platform’s pricing is substantial, ranging from $33,000 to over $1,000,000, reflecting its high-end, custom nature. While powerful for in-home automation, it does not include AI tools for content creation, lead capture, or business intelligence. Installers seeking to scale their business beyond individual projects may find Crestron’s focus on hardware and installation limiting for broader digital growth.

Control4
Best for: Home automation installers working on custom, high-end residential and commercial projects who need a reliable, scalable platform for in-home automation.
Control4 is a premium smart home brand that offers whole-home automation for lighting, entertainment, climate, and security. According to their website, Control4’s Smart Home OS 3 serves as a central hub, allowing users to manage connected devices easily through a unified interface. The platform supports a wide range of products, including smart lighting, home security systems, multi-room audio, and climate control. Control4 is known for its professional installation and integration with both residential and commercial environments. The system is designed to be user-friendly and reliable, with a focus on seamless operation. For home automation installers, Control4 provides a robust platform to deliver sophisticated, integrated automation solutions. It’s particularly strong in commercial and custom home applications, where reliability and ease of use are critical. The platform is part of Snap One, which enhances its distribution and support network. However, like Crestron, Control4 is a hardware and software system focused on in-home device management, not on digital marketing or lead generation. It does not include features such as AI-powered content creation, automated business reports, or a built-in leads inbox. Installers can use Control4 to demonstrate technical prowess and deliver high-quality installations, but they must manage their business growth through separate digital channels. The platform’s pricing is competitive for its class, but it still requires a significant investment in both hardware and professional services. For installers looking to build a digital presence and attract more clients, Control4 alone does not provide the tools needed to scale beyond individual projects.
